使用Go语言开发网关插件
开发网关插件可以扩展API网关的核心功能,使其能够满足更加复杂和特定的业务需求。本文介绍如何使用Go语言开发网关插件,并提供了本地开发和调试的指引。
使用Go语言开发网关插件扩展网关功能
开发网关插件可以扩展API网关的核心功能,使其能够满足更加复杂和特定的业务需求。本文介绍如何使用Go语言开发网关插件,并提供了本地开发和调试的指引。
编译打包并部署go语言
Go是静态编译型语言,不支持在函数计算控制台在线编辑代码,您需要在本地自行编译程序并打包为.zip文件。本文介绍如何将函数计算官方Go SDK库与您的代码一同打包并上传至函数计算。
Go语言中的并发编程模型解析####
在现代软件开发中,随着多核处理器的普及和互联网应用对高并发的需求日益增长,传统的单线程编程模型已难以满足高效处理大量并行任务的要求。Go语言作为一门新兴的编程语言,凭借其简洁的语法和强大的标准库支持,在并发编程方面展现出了独特的优势。其中,Go语言的两大核心特性——goroutines(轻量级线程)...
Go语言的并发编程模型
Go语言的并发编程模型基于通信顺序进程(CSP)模型,通过goroutines和channels实现高效并发。以下是对Go语言并发编程模型的详细解释: Goroutines 轻量级线程:Goroutines是Go语言中的轻量级线程,由Go运行时管理,而非操作系统。它们占用内存少,创建和...
探索Go语言的并发编程模型及其在现代应用中的优势
引言 在当今的软件开发领域,并发编程已成为提升系统性能和响应速度的关键技术之一。Go语言,作为一种新兴且迅速崛起的编程语言,凭借其独特的并发编程模型——goroutines和channels,在并发编程领域独树一帜。本文将深入探讨Go语言的并发编程模型,解析其内在机制,并阐述在现代应用中采用Go语言进行并发编程的...
开发与运维线程问题之Go语言的goroutine基于线程模型实现如何解决
问题一:Go语言的goroutine是基于什么线程模型实现的? Go语言的goroutine是基于什么线程模型实现的? 参考回答: Go语言的goroutine是基于M:N线程模型实现的。在Go语言中,一个进程可以启动成千上万个goroutine,这些goroutine由Go运行时(runtime)调度到多个内核级线程上执行,从而实现了高并发的处理能力...
探索Go语言的并发编程模型
引言Go语言(Golang)自2009年发布以来,以其简洁、高效、并发支持良好等特点迅速在开发者群体中流行起来。Go语言内置了丰富的并发编程机制,使得开发者可以轻松地编写高性能的并发程序。本文将深入探讨Go语言的并发编程模型,通过实例展示如何利用goroutine和channel进行高效的并发编程。Goroutine的基本概念...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Go更多语言相关
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注